  • 製品の概要

    LDH Assay Kit (Cytotoxicity) ab65393 uses WST for the fast and sensitive detection of LDH released from damaged cells.


    The LDH assay, also known as LDH release assay, is a cell death / cytotoxicity assay used to assess the level of plasma membrane damage in a cell population. Lactate dehydrogenase (LDH) is a stable enzyme, present in all cell types, which is rapidly released into the cell culture medium upon damage of the plasma membrane. LDH is the most widely used marker used to run a cytotoxicity assay.


    How the assay works
    The LDH assay protocol is based on an enzymatic coupling reaction: LDH released from the cell oxidizes lactate to generate NADH, which then reacts with WST to generate a yellow color. The intensity of the generated color correlates directly with the number of lyzed cells.


    Only 10μl of culture medium is required for the assay, and thus background from serum and culture medium is significantly reduced. Cells can be cultured in regular 10% serum containing medium; no reducing serum or special medium is required for the assay.


    This LDH assay kit uses a chemical method to couple the NADH reaction with WST, which is more tolerant of variability in the sample than the diaphorase-based coupling method used in kits available from other vendors. The chemical method means that the active ingredients of the kit, excluding the LDH positive control, do not contain enzymes, meaning they are more stable for practical use in the lab in repeated experiments.


    In addition, the WST used in the kit is highly stable, soluble in solution and unlikely to precipitate in solution, unlike the INT used in kits available from other vendors. This means that the reaction can be read multiple times over a long time-course. The reaction can also be stopped at any time point.


    LDH assay protocol summary


    - Transfer 10μl culture medium into new plate
    - Add LDH reaction mix and incubate for 30 min at room temp
    - Analyze with microplate reader


    LDH activity can be easily quantified by spectrophotometer or plate reader at OD450nm.


    Related LDH assay products
    If you would like to use a fluorometric assay, please refer to LDH-Cytotoxicity Assay Kit (Fluorometric) ab197004.


    This kit is more sensitive than the colorimetric LDH Cytoxicity Assay Kit ab65391.


    To measure LDH activity in sample types such as serum, plasma, and cell lysates, we recommend LDH assay kit ab102526.

画像

  • LDH Cytotoxicity Assay using ab65393
    LDH Cytotoxicity Assay using ab65393Image from Bukong TN et al., PLoS Pathog 10(10), Fig S6. Doi: 10.1371/journal.ppat.1004424. Reproduced under the Creative Commons license http://creativecommons.org/licenses/by/4.0/

    Bafilomycin A1 (BafA1) toxicity was assessed in Human hepatic (Huh7.5) cells after 24 hours at different concentrations (12.5nm, 25nm, 50nm and 100nm) were administered to cells using LDH cytotoxicity assay kit (ab65393). Cytotoxicity was measured by subtracting LDH content in remaining viable cells from total LDH in untreated controls. 

  • LDH Cytotoxicity Assay useing ab65393
    LDH Cytotoxicity Assay useing ab65393

    Jurkat T cells were cultured in 96-well plate in 100 μl of culture medium. LDH Assay was performed using 10μl of culture medium using the WST probe. Low control (white bar); High control (black bar).

  • LDH Cytotoxicity Assay using ab65393
    LDH Cytotoxicity Assay using ab65393

    Comparison of WST-1 and INT based LDH assays. 3T3 cells were cultured in a 96-well plate in 100 µl of culture medium. The LDH assay was performed using 10 µl of culture medium using WST-1 (Brown bar) and INT (Green bar) methods. The WST-1 based LDH assay is more stable and sensitive than the INT based method.

Question

what is the difference between both kits?
can one them to be used with tissue culture supernatant only (no cells)?

Read More

Abcam community

Verified customer

Asked on Nov 06 2012

Answer

Thank you for contacting us.

I have heard back from the lab with the following information:

There are numerous differences between these two assay kits. For details, I have attached the datasheets, but here are the main differences:






Kit
ab65391
ab65393

Detection wavelength
500 nm
450 nm

Principle
LDH activity can be determined by a
coupled enzymatic reaction: LDH oxidizes lactate to pyruvate which then reacts with
tetrazolium salt INT to form formazan. The increase in the amount of formazan produced in
culture supernatant directly correlates to the increase in the number of lysed cells.
The assay utilizing an enzymatic coupling reaction: LDH oxidizes
lactate to generate NADH, which then reacts with WST to generate yellow color. The intensity
of the generated color correlates directly with the cell number lysed.

Special advantages:

Since WST is brighter,
less amount of culture medium is required for the assay, and thus the background from serum
and culture medium is significantly reduced. Using the assay, cells can be cultured in regular
10% serum containing medium, no reducing serum or special medium is required for the
assay. In addition, since the WST is more stable, the reaction can be read multiple times, and
can also be stopped at any time point during the reaction. LDH activity can be easily quantified
by spectrophotometer or plate reader at OD450 nm. The kit provides all necessary reagents
including LDH positive control.






One can use only the cell media with these kits.

Answer

Thank you for contacting us.

Can you please clarify the difference between your CON samples and your LC? It seems like both sets of samples are cells without treatment, is that correct?

What sort of background readings were you getting on your plate?

I would suggest checking your cells under a microscope to validate that the cells in your low control are healthy and intact, and that the cells in your high control have been effectively lysed. Because the OD readings in your high control are not quite at the ˜2.0 OD level that is recommended in the protocol, the lysis may not be effective, or you may need to seed more cells per well to get accurate readings.

Once the low and high controls are optimized, a negative reading would indicate that you have more cells in your treated samples than in your controls. If the wells are all seeded evenly, this could indicate that your treatments may be encouraging cell division.
